HOW MANY SAME EXPLORER WERE MADE?

Since 2001, there have been 60 SAME EXPLORER sold & registered for use on UK roads.

HOW MANY SAME EXPLORER ARE LEFT?

There are 57 SAME EXPLORER still on the road in the UK. This means that 95% of all SAME EXPLORER sold in the UK are left.
